AN ACT
To direct the National Science Foundation to support STEM education
research focused on early childhood.
Be it enacted by the Senate and House of Representatives of the
United States of America in Congress assembled,
SECTION 1. SHORT TITLE.
This Act may be cited as the ``Building Blocks of STEM Act''.
SEC. 2. FINDINGS.
Congress finds the following:
(1) The National Science Foundation is a large investor in
STEM education and plays a key role in setting research and
policy agendas.
(2) While studies have found that children who engage in
scientific activities from an early age develop positive
attitudes toward science and are more likely to pursue STEM
expertise and careers later on, the majority of current
research focuses on increasing STEM opportunities for middle
school-aged children and older.
(3) Women remain widely underrepresented in the STEM
workforce, and this disparity extends down through all levels
of education.
SEC. 3. SUPPORTING EARLY CHILDHOOD AND ELEMENTARY STEM EDUCATION
RESEARCH.
In awarding grants under the Discovery Research PreK-12 program,
the Director of the National Science Foundation shall consider the age
distribution of a STEM education research and development project to
improve the focus of research and development on elementary and
prekindergarten education.
SEC. 4. SUPPORTING FEMALE STUDENTS IN PREKINDERGARTEN THROUGH
ELEMENTARY SCHOOL IN STEM EDUCATION.
Section 305(d) of the American Innovation and Competitiveness Act
(42 U.S.C. 1862s-5(d)) is amended by adding at the end the following:
``(3) Research.--As a component of improving participation
of women in STEM fields, research funded by a grant under this
subsection may include research on--
``(A) the role of teacher training and professional
development, including effective incentive structures
to encourage teachers to participate in such training
and professional development, in encouraging or
discouraging female students in prekindergarten through
elementary school from participating in STEM
activities;
``(B) the role of teachers in shaping perceptions
of STEM in female students in prekindergarten through
elementary school and discouraging such students from
participating in STEM activities;
``(C) the role of other facets of the learning
environment on the willingness of female students in
prekindergarten through elementary school to
participate in STEM activities, including learning
materials and textbooks, seating arrangements, use of
media and technology, classroom culture, and
composition of students during group work;
``(D) the role of parents and other caregivers in
encouraging or discouraging female students in
prekindergarten through elementary school from
participating in STEM activities;
``(E) the types of STEM activities that encourage
greater participation by female students in
prekindergarten through elementary school;
``(F) the role of mentorship and best practices in
finding and utilizing mentors; and
``(G) the role of informal and after-school STEM
learning opportunities on the perception of and
participation in STEM activities of female students in
prekindergarten through elementary school.''.
SEC. 5. SUPPORTING FEMALE STUDENTS IN PREKINDERGARTEN THROUGH
ELEMENTARY SCHOOL IN COMPUTER SCIENCE EDUCATION.
Section 310(b) of the American Innovation and Competitiveness Act
(42 U.S.C. 1862s-7(b)) is amended by adding at the end the following:
``(3) Uses of funds.--The tools and models described in
paragraph (2)(C) may include--
``(A) offering training and professional
development programs, including summer or academic year
institutes or workshops, designed to strengthen the
capabilities of prekindergarten and elementary school
teachers and to familiarize such teachers with the role
of bias against female students in the classroom;
``(B) offering innovative pre-service and in-
service programs that instruct teachers on female-
inclusive practices for teaching computing concepts;
``(C) developing distance learning programs for
teachers or students, including developing curricular
materials, play-based computing activities, and other
resources for the in-service professional development
of teachers that are made available to teachers through
the Internet;
``(D) developing or adapting prekindergarten and
elementary school computer science curricular materials
that incorporate contemporary research on the science
of learning, particularly with respect to female
inclusion;
``(E) developing and offering female-inclusive
computer science enrichment programs for students,
including after-school and summer programs;
``(F) providing mentors for female students in
prekindergarten through elementary school to support
such students in participating in computer science
activities;
``(G) engaging female students in prekindergarten
through elementary school, and their guardians (if such
communication takes place on school premises during
otherwise-scheduled conferences or formal conversations
between teachers and guardians) about--
``(i) the difficulties faced by female
students with regard to maintaining an interest
in participating in computer science
activities; and
``(ii) the potential positive career
benefits of engaging in such activities;
``(H) acquainting female students in
prekindergarten through elementary school with careers
in computer science and encouraging such students to
consider careers in the computer science field; and
``(I) developing tools to evaluate activities
conducted under this subsection, including reports for
evaluating the effectiveness of activities under this
section.''.
